René Froger’s Past Relationship Under Scrutiny as Natasja Froger Discusses Affair
The early days of René and Natasja Froger’s relationship are once again in the spotlight, following Natasja Froger’s recent appearance on the SBS 6 show, It Were 2 Fantastic Days. Her candid recounting of how their romance began, specifically her claim of not knowing René Froger was married at the time, has drawn criticism, notably from Yvonne Coldeweijer.
The Affair Revealed
René Froger left his first wife, Yolanda, and their family to pursue a relationship with Natasja Froger. Natasja has described the initial encounter as a chance meeting while she worked as a flight attendant for KLM Cityhopper and Martinair. According to Froger, she was unaware of his marital status. “I honestly didn’t know he was married,” she stated on the program. “And I will notify you, if I had known, probably the same thing would have happened.”
The pair reportedly developed an immediate connection. Froger recounted a moment where René encountered her while traveling with his wife and child, leading to a conversation where he admitted his situation. She famously responded, “What happened in Athens, stays in Athens,” attempting to downplay the initial encounter.
Backlash and Criticism
Yvonne Coldeweijer publicly criticized Natasja Froger’s account, stating, “He left his two children for you!” Mediacourant.nl reports that this comment sparked a debate about the narrative surrounding the affair and its impact on René Froger’s children.
Family Impact
The situation has resurfaced painful memories for René Froger’s son, Maxim Froger, who has previously spoken about feeling neglected by his parents. Showblad.nl details Maxim’s claims of a lack of parental support.
Current Status
Despite the controversy surrounding its origins, René and Natasja Froger remain married. Natasja Froger’s recent openness about the beginning of their relationship has reignited public discussion about the affair and its lasting consequences.
